According to an ancient prophecy, the Aztecs will rise again before the end of 1999. Buffy must defeat the Aztec god of darkness or doom the world to eternal night, thus allowing the vampires free... This description may be from another edition of this product.

If you are a fan of Buffy-related fiction, this one is a must. Diana Gallagher has all of the characters down pat, and each of them speaks and acts true to their TV characters (which isn't always the case with authors who may not be all that familiar with the show). This intriguing story seems to take place shortly before the 3rd season episode "Helpless." A few continuity problems aside (as well as some annoying mispellings -- Angeles instead of Angelus), this book is a truly great Buffy book. A must for any die-hard fan.
